The Red Wings players are having a pretty solid Olympics. The Wings sent 10 players over to Sochi and three personnel (four if you count Stevie Y). Datsyuk and Zetterberg were the captains of Russia and Sweden until Zetterberg suffered an injury in the first game. No problem though because another Wing took over as captain of Sweden, Nik Kronwall. Sweden was the team that a ton of experts picked to win the gold medal. Right now I find it a little difficult for that team to generate the offense it would need to beat Canada or USA. With Sedin, Franzen and Zetterberg not playing they will have to look for other means of scoring. Look for Nyquist, Loui Eriksson and Eric Karlsson to have a huge game against Finland. Gustavsson and Howard have not seen any playing time for their countries but that is good for the Red Wings. Howard came into the Olympics with a nagging knee injury so it is good for him to have some rest. And Gustavsson is playing behind one of the best goalies in the world. Right now 5 of the 10 Red Wings have advanced to the medal round. Let’s hope for a healthy Zetterberg when this is over and a 23rd straight playoff appearance for Hockeytown.
